Description Suggest change

Approach the mouth of twomile canyon and hike up short talus on the south side to a north facing wall with several promising cracks. Route climbs thin fingers in a left facing dihedral to an offwidth roof (crux) then goes hands forever.

Protection Suggest change

Many cams for continuous 50m crack. Extra hand sizes!
